Hi, Le jeudi 16 novembre 2006 à 17:31 +0100, Jaap Keuter a écrit : > Hi, > > See for yourself in the attached capture. > Thanks, seems to be a trailer cf the 802.3 ethernet packet, I've double check with Inside Appletalk, netatalk source code and an OS9 capture, all of them use 1 byte + 4 bytes, follow by the zone name. What is it? A Zyxel NAS or router? If ATALK_PS8011 2D-3 is really your zone name it could be a bug in the router.
